The 8 Best Places to See Cherry Blossoms in the United States

Spring brings with it one of nature’s most breathtaking spectacles: cherry blossoms in full bloom. While Japan may be renowned for its stunning cherry blossoms, you don’t have to travel overseas to witness this ethereal beauty. The United States boasts several destinations where you can experience the magic of cherry blossoms in bloom. From coast to coast, here are the eight best places in the U.S. to see these delicate flowers paint the landscape in shades of pink and white.

Washington, D.C.

When it comes to cherry blossoms in the United States, Washington, D.C. is undoubtedly the first destination that comes to mind. Each year, the National Cherry Blossom Festival draws thousands of visitors to the nation’s capital to witness the blooming of thousands of cherry trees gifted by Japan in 1912. The Tidal Basin, with its iconic backdrop of the Jefferson Memorial, offers a postcard-perfect setting for enjoying the cherry blossoms in all their glory.

Brooklyn Botanic Garden, New York

Escape the hustle and bustle of New York City by immersing yourself in the serene beauty of the Brooklyn Botanic Garden. Home to over 200 cherry trees of various species, the garden explodes into a riot of pink and white blossoms come springtime. Stroll along the Cherry Esplanade or visit the Japanese Hill-and-Pond Garden for a tranquil cherry blossom viewing experience.

Macon, Georgia

For a Southern twist on cherry blossom season, head to Macon, Georgia, where you’ll find over 350,000 Yoshino cherry trees in bloom. The annual International Cherry Blossom Festival celebrates this blooming spectacle with events like cherry blossom-themed concerts, street parties, and food festivals. Don’t miss the Cherry Blossom Parade, where colorful floats wind their way through the streets adorned with—you guessed it—cherry blossoms!

Portland, Oregon

In the Pacific Northwest, Portland boasts its own cherry blossom extravaganza at the Portland Japanese Garden. Nestled within the scenic hills of Washington Park, this garden features several varieties of cherry trees, including the iconic Yoshino cherry. Take a leisurely stroll through the garden’s meticulously landscaped grounds and pause to admire the delicate beauty of the cherry blossoms against the backdrop of tranquil ponds and traditional Japanese architecture.

San Francisco, California

San Francisco’s Japantown comes alive with color during cherry blossom season, thanks to the annual Northern California Cherry Blossom Festival. This vibrant celebration of Japanese culture features taiko drumming performances, traditional tea ceremonies, and, of course, cherry blossom viewing parties. Take a walk through Japantown’s Peace Plaza and Buchanan Mall to admire the cherry trees in full bloom while indulging in delicious Japanese street food.

Dallas, Texas

Dallas may not be the first place that comes to mind when you think of cherry blossoms, but the Dallas Arboretum and Botanical Garden will make you think again. Every March and April, the arboretum’s Cherry Blossom Festival transforms the gardens into a sea of pink and white blossoms. Pack a picnic and spend the day wandering through the arboretum’s lush landscapes, taking in the beauty of the cherry trees in bloom.

Philadelphia, Pennsylvania

Philadelphia’s Shofuso Japanese House and Garden offers a serene escape from the city’s urban hustle and bustle. Modeled after a traditional Japanese tea house, Shofuso is surrounded by a picturesque garden featuring cherry trees, Japanese maples, and tranquil ponds. Visit during cherry blossom season to experience the garden in full bloom and participate in traditional Japanese cultural activities like tea ceremonies and ikebana flower arranging.

Seattle, Washington

Known for its stunning natural beauty, Seattle also boasts its fair share of cherry blossoms. The University of Washington’s Quad is home to over 30 cherry trees that burst into bloom each spring, creating a breathtaking canopy of pink and white flowers. Take a leisurely stroll through the campus to admire the cherry blossoms against the backdrop of historic buildings and the majestic Mount Rainier in the distance.
